Zucchini and Potato Patties Recipe

★Ingredients

2 medium potatoes, peeled and grated

1 small onion, finely chopped

2 medium zucchinis, grated

2 cloves garlic, minced

1/2 cup breadcrumbs

1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ese

1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ley

1 egg, beaten

Salt and pepper to taste

Olive oil for frying

★Instructions

  1. Prepare the vegetables: Grate the zucchinis and potatoes using a box grater. Place them in a clean kitchen towel or cheesecloth and squeeze out as much liquid as possible.
  2. Combine ingredients: In a large bowl, combine the grated zucchinis, potatoes, chopped onion, minced garlic, breadcrumbs, Parmesan cheese, parsley, beaten egg, salt, and pepper. Mix well until everything is evenly combined.
  3. Form patties: Take a portion of the mixture and shape it into a patty about 1/2 inch thick. Repeat with the remaining mixture.
  4. Cook patties: Heat a couple of tablespoons of ol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the patties to the skillet (in batches if necessary) and cook for about 4-5 minutes per side, or until they are golden brown and crispy.
  5. Serve: Once cooked, transfer the patties to a plate lined with paper towels to drain excess oil. Serve hot as a side dish or a light main course. Optionally, serve with sour cream or yogurt sauce.
